The 5-step method is a proven path from "I've never seen this material" to "I'm scoring 90%+ on timed mock exams." The order matters — each step builds the recall and understanding the next one assumes.
Step 1 — Answer Imprint
You see each question with the correct answer already shown. The goal isn't to test you yet; it's to imprint the right answer so it feels familiar later. Move through quickly.
Step 2 — Recognition Drill
Now you're quizzed: pick an answer, then the app reveals whether you were right and explains why. This builds fast, reliable recognition of the correct choice.

Step 3 — Full Practice
Work the entire question bank for your exam, category by category, so nothing is left uncovered.
Step 4 — Weak Point Focus
Drill only the questions you've missed or flagged. This is where scores climb fastest — you stop wasting time on what you already know.
Step 5 — Exam Simulation
Timed, scored mock exams under realistic conditions. Treat these like the real thing. When you're consistently hitting 90%+ here, you're ready to schedule your test.
Tip: 20 focused minutes a day, in order, beats a weekend cram. Keep your streak alive on the dashboard.
